Psykososiaalisin refers to the study of social psychology, focusing on individual consciousness and behavior within the context of societal relationships. This field seeks to understand how social influences affect normal psychological processes and vice versa. In essence, psychosocial phenomena are intersection points between individual psychology and societal factors such as culture and social structure.
The concept of psychosocial is most commonly associated with the work of American psychoanalyst Erik Erikson.
